How To Use

Charging
  1. Placing Charging Dock

    • Plug the adaptor into the charging dock;
    • Align it well and place the mat under the charging dock;
    • Put the charging dock against a wall and remove obstacles and reflective objects about 1 meter on both sides and about 2 meters in front;
    • Connect to power.
    • ILIFE A10 Laser Navigation Robotic Vacuum-6 Note:
      Once connected to power, indicator light on the charging dock stays on.
  2. Turning on Power Switch
    Turn on the power switch on the side of the main body. is ON and 11011 is OFF. Note:
    Do not switch off the robot after use. Always keep the robot fully charged for the next task.

  3. Charging the Robot
    Auto Charge

    • When battery runs low in Auto mode, robot will automatically search the charging dock for recharge.

    • While on standby, press GD button on the remote control. Robot will start searching the charging dock for recharge.
      Reminder:
      To avoid lowered charging performance, make sure the charging pads on the main body and charging dock are clean.
      Manual Charge

    • Turn on the power switch on the side of the main body. Plug in the adaptor and connect to power. Reminders:

    • For regular use, always leave the main body on the charging dock, and make sure its power switch is turned on.

    • If the robot will not be used for a long time, fully charge it before storing in a cool, dry place.

    • Do not charge the robot manually after a cleaning schedule is set. The robot will not execute scheduled cleaning after a manual charge.

Cleaning Modes
Multiple cleaning modes allow robot to perform deep cleaning in different environment and on different floorings. Use the remote control to select a suitable cleaning mode.

  • Before select cleaning modes.make sure the robot is standby (power switch is on and the auto button is lighting green).
  1. Auto Mode
    The most frequently used cleaning mode. Press G) on the main body or 8 on the remote control.
    Robot plans a path and cleans along a zigzag pattern.
    During cleaning, robot detects and cleans areas that have been missed.
    Robot plans a cleaning path autonomously during a cleaning cycle. If robot is moved manually or with the remote control, it will plan a new path and may repeat areas that have been cleaned.Robot may stop working briefly during a cleaning cycle. Wait patiently for it to detect areas that have been missed or to revise the cleaning path. The number and duration of these brief stops depend on the complexity of the home environment.

  2. Spot Mode
    Robot takes a square path to clean a specific area with concentrated dust and debris.ILIFE A10 Laser Navigation Robotic
Vacuum-11

  3. Edge Mode
    While on standby, robot moves forward until it detects a wall. It cleans around the edges of the walls about once.

  4. Suction Switch
    Suction can be strengthened or weakened to meet different cleaning needs. Press the button GD on remote control to switch to different suction level.

  5. Auto Charge
    When battery runs low during a cleaning cycle, robot will automatically activate “Auto Charge” function -­searching and returning to charging dock for recharge.

Maintenance

Make sure the main body is turned off and adaptor is unplugged before accessories maintenance.
Cleaning Side Brushes & Main Brush

Cleaning Side Brushes
Remove side brushes.
Wipe clean with a clean cloth.
Cleaning Main Brush
Remove main brush cover. Take out main brush. Cut the hair winding around the brush for easy removal.ILIFE A10 Laser Navigation Robotic
Vacuum-21

Cleaning Sensors & Charging Pins

Use cleaning tools or a soft cloth to clean the sensors and charging pins: Note: Remove dust or foreign objects on sensors and charging pins on the charging dock as soon as possible. ILIFE A10 Laser Navigation Robotic
Vacuum-22

Cleaning Dustbin & Filters

Clean dustbin and filters after each use:

  1. Take out the dustbin. Check the suction port if there is anything stuck in it. Clean suction port if needed.
  2. Wash replaceable primary filter with water every 15-30 days. Do not squeeze. Air dry after wash.
  3. Tap to remove dust from the high-performance filter. Do not wash with water.
